About this course
Friction is a critical force in classical mechanics, yet calculating its effect in real-world scenarios often confuses beginners. This course provides a structured, text-based foundation for understanding and analyzing frictional forces.
By the end of this program, you will be able to distinguish between static and kinetic friction, accurately calculate coefficients, and integrate friction into complex force analysis using rigorous mathematical methods and clear problem-solving steps.
What you'll learn:
* Understand the fundamental differences between static, kinetic, and rolling friction.
* Learn to construct and interpret detailed Free-Body Diagrams (FBDs) for systems experiencing friction.
* Apply Newton's laws of motion to solve for acceleration, tension, and necessary external forces in frictional systems.
* Practice calculating the coefficient of static friction and determining the angle of repose for various materials.
* Analyze common scenarios like blocks on inclined planes and connected masses over pulleys with friction present.
* Master the vector decomposition techniques required for forces on non-horizontal surfaces.
The course begins with defining key terminology and the physical laws governing friction. It then moves into step-by-step guidance on constructing force diagrams and culminates in practical problem sets that reinforce numerical analysis skills.
This course is designed for absolute beginners in physics or introductory mechanics who need a clear, text-based explanation of frictional forces. No prior advanced physics knowledge is required.
